Introduction - Dreams To Reality


Hello and welcome to my first blog on the Estemerwalt's Dreams To Reality website. I am thrilled to be bringing you along on this journey as my family and I build our dream log home in Northwest Pennsylvania. Since this is my first entry I should tell you a little bit about myself and what the Dreams To Reality website is all about.

I am an avid outdoorsmen and the owner of the Sportsmen Portal, a hunting and fishing website dedicated to my passion. Being a country boy at heart and growing up on the hillsides of Northwest PA I always had a dream to build my own log home someday.

For the past 13 years I have been living in the city and working as the Director of Marketing and Strategic planning of a health system. I came to the realization that I wanted something different for me and my family, and that included a more rural lifestyle with a log home. So I quit my job at the health system and here I am working full time for myself.

I have a wonderful family, wife Liza, son Colin, and daughter Addison and they have always been supportive of me and my goals and we are all very excited about moving to the country! You will probably be seeing much more of them over the next 10 months as we build our home.
